WebMar 2, 2024 · Abstract. A mathematical model is developed based on the thin-walled … WebOct 16, 2024 · Thin-walled approximation is a very easy way to estimate the section properties. It uses a very simple concept, in which the area of an object is replaced with a line and a fixed thickness. This means that it forms a rectangle for each object. This must be kept in mind when dealing with curves and fillets. Area of Section albina marcio sordi https://designchristelle.com

WebSep 30, 2024 · An efficient formulation is developed for the elastic analysis of thin-walled beams curved in plan. Using a second-order rotation tensor, the strain values of the deformed configuration are calculated in terms of the displacement values and the initial curvature by adopting the right extensional strain measure. WebA uniform beam element of open thin-walled cross-section is studied under stationary harmonic end excitation. An exact dynamic (transcendentally frequency-dependent) 14 × 14 element stiffness matrix is derived from Vlasov's coupled differential equations.
